The middle Owyhee has more water, which makes for bigger waves and holes. This can be some of the most exciting boating anywhere. Bring an adventurous spirit and be ready for a great time. The Owyhee River's reputation as a big-time whitewater river is well deserved, but there is a quieter side to these beautiful canyons, and the Lower Owyhee has whitewater that is suitable for families. We often see bighorn sheep as we drift along, or surprise them when we are exploring the tight-walled side canyons. We'll also visit some historic trapping and homestead cabins along the way and marvel at the determination of those who made a living in this rough land. A hike to the canyon rim to spot antelope far off in the sagebrush can be a highlight of the trip. Looking out over the miles of open country really gives you a feel for what one guest called the "awesome vastness" of this country. The warms springs on the Middle Owyhee are always a popular stop for boaters.

Your Itinerary

Day 1: Drive from Boise to Crutchers Crossing. After rigging and lunch we'll head down the river. Right away we'll hit a couple of good rapids. Make camp and take a short hike.

Days 2 - Day 5: We float from Idaho into Oregon and run several Class III & IV rapids. There is some beautiful quiet floating until we get below Three Forks. We can take some excellent hikes, see ancient petroglyphs, soak in a natural warm springs, and probably catch a glimpse of bighorn sheep. After Three Forks the action picks up and we run a series of exciting class III to V rapids. The final rapid is Widow Maker, which may have to be lined or portaged.

Day 6: A fairly quiet and tranquil float down to Rome. Drive back to Boise for the evening. Those continuing will now be on the on the Lower Owyhee.
